One of a Kind to host grand opening

PORT ANGELES — It didn’t take long for Mary Comeau to fill every empty artist space in her new gallery, One of a Kind.

Before advertising of any kind, word of mouth spread across Port Angeles.

But for those who have yet to see the newest gallery at The Landing mall, visitors will be treated to an all-day grand opening Saturday from 10:30 a.m. to 5 p.m.

Inside, jewelry, pottery, woodwork, stained glass, original paintings, photography, prints and cards await.

The grand opening also comes at a provident time: the unveiling of a coffee bar.

Saturday’s visitors will receive a complimentary beverage as they listen to live music by the New Life Worship Band and enjoy resident artists’ demonstrations.

They also can enter raffle drawings for artwork and sign up for upcoming classes at the counter.

Raffle tickets can be purchased anytime at the gallery, 115 E. Railroad Ave., during regular business hours — 10:30 a.m. to 5 p.m. every day — today through Sunday.

One of a Kind took residence in September in the space that once housed Heatherton Gallery, fulfilling Comeau’s longtime dream.

Adding to the well-known, established artists from Heatherton, up-and-coming artists to One of a Kind include Pam Fries, Antonia Busonera, Helena Rose, Maria Cook, Linda Norris, Annie Sumpter, Hazelle Hout and Pam Dick, according to a news release.
